Food Lion To Buy 62 Bi-Lo / Harvey's Stores From Southeastern Grocers

Post by Alpha8472 »

Food Lion will buy 62 Bi-Lo / Harvey's stores from Southeastern Grocers. The stores will be converted to the Food Lion banner in the first half of 2021.

Southeastern is focusing on its largest chain Winn-Dixie and is looking to phase out the Bi-Lo banner.

Re: Food Lion To Buy 62 Bi-Lo / Harvey's Stores From Southeastern Grocers

Post by Groceteria »

Harvey’s was indeed formerly owned by Delhaize. Southeastern has run it as a “value“ brand, and a good chunk of the stores are former Bi-Lo locations.
